Adventures, Capers and Escapes - Danger Shop, Thursday Period 3

The Doctor opened the Danger Shop doors right on time for class to start. He looked alarmed to see them all there and then looked at the device on his arm that appeared to be some sort of leather bracelet with a doohickey on it. "She's definitely been tinkering with this. You!" he said to them, snapping back to the present. "All of you. Hello. Is it class time? Perfect. I need your help. I don't know why, but at some time in my own personal future, I'm going to program the Danger Shop to be an amusement park filled with zombie clowns that can only be incapacitated by cream pies. For reasons also unknown, but I can't wait to find out, the program is locked down so it won't end until all of the zombie clowns are cream pied into oblivion. That's where you come in. Can you cream pie the zombie clowns for me? To cut a long, complicated and very interesting story short, I have to go in search of a message I left myself in here and then go and save the universe from complete and total annihilation. It's about as interesting as it sounds. Off we go!"

He turned and ran into the amusement park, trying to dodge the zombie clowns that wanted to harass him. There were cream pie stations throughout the park. It was night time, of course, but the lights were all on and the rides were ready to go if you really wanted to ride one or use them as part of your zombie pieing plans.
